目的对肝硬变时去甲肾上腺素(NE)的肝清除力进行定性观察。方法采用改良Miller’s法建立硬变肝脏隔离灌流模型(IPCRL)行单程灌流,测定NE的首过肝摄取率及清除率。结果肝硬变时NE肝摄取率(32.42%±15.38%或1.78%±0.75%/g肝重)和清除率(5.99±3.35ml/min或0.32±0.21ml/min·g肝重)均明显低于正常肝脏灌流模型(IPRL)(P<0.05~0.001)。结论肝硬变时肝脏对NE的摄取清除能力明显降低。
Objective To observe the liver clearance of norepinephrine (NE) during cirrhosis. Methods The improved Miller’s method was used to establish the rigid liver isolation perfusion model (IPCRL) undergoing single pass perfusion to determine the first-pass hepatic uptake rate and clearance rate of NE. Results The hepatic uptake rate (32.42% ± 15.38% or 1.78% ± 0.75% / g liver weight) and clearance rate (5.99 ± 3.35ml / min or 0.32 ± 0.21ml / min · g liver weight) Lower than the normal liver perfusion model (IPRL) (P <0.05 ~ 0.001). Conclusion Liver cirrhosis of the liver uptake of NE was significantly reduced.
